The Russian military had/has ghille-type unis that produce a nice 3D camo effect. The winter version is called "werewolf" and the summer version is called "goblin". Might look around at the various soviet surplus sites and see if you can't score a deal.

Honestly, I have seen commercial ghillies, and never liked a single one. I made one from some stuff lying around and it took me about 2 days. If your serious about it, you will just make your own. Store bought ones never look the same as the one I built in the service, and wouldn't dare stand up against the abuse that your gonna expect.

Here is the one that took me 2 days to build. I will admit, that I already had all the materials in my closet, and just put them together. Prep of coat took me about 6 hours, dying the burlap was overnight, and then tying them to the net took me the entire next day (also included drying the burlap in sun, cutting into strips, and parting the threads)
